Company Description: Established in 2025, Globally Linked Ltd (trading as AiTechTouchTM) is an AIâpowered learning platform and STEM workshop program designed to make education more inclusive, practical, and globally connected, funded by Innovate UK and the Create Growth Programme. We blend smart technologies like AI and robotics with realâworld projects to inspire creativity, critical thinking, and sustainability in every child. We believe technology is a tool, not a replacement. By using it wisely, children can become confident problemâsolvers, ready to shape a better future.
About the Role: AiTechTouch is seeking a Product Manager to lead the development and testing of our bilingual web prototype during the Innovate UK pilot phase. This role is ideal for a structured, handsâon individual who can bridge design, technology, and learning. You will oversee prototype design, manage developer progress, ensure accessibility and bilingual usability (EN/ES), and deliver a polished, testâready product aligned with AiTechTouch's mission and safeguarding standards.
What You Will Do:
- Product Ownership: Lead the design of the clickable web prototype and integrated feedback form. Define MVP scope, user journeys, and success criteria in collaboration with mentors. Translate learning goals into clear, testable UI flows. Maintain the product backlog and monitor milestone progress.
- Coordination & Delivery: Coordinate testing sessions with Leeds student testers, mentors, and facilitators. Conduct internal accessibility testing (EN/ES bilingual interface). Prepare a concise handover package (UI documentation, backlog summary, and video walkthrough). Design and implement online feedback forms for parents, educators, and facilitators. Ensure all feedback is aggregated, anonymised, and GDPRâcompliant. Align dataâcapture questions with Innovate UK metrics and educational goals.
About You: 2+ years' experience in product management, UI/UX, or digital prototyping. Strong technical and design skills using Figma, Webflow, Bubble, Glide, or Miro. Excellent communication, coordination, and documentation skills. Experience managing small, agile, or innovationâfocused teams. Based in or near Leeds for occasional inâperson meetings. Bonus if you have experience in EdTech, STEM, or multilingual user design.
